Resultados da pesquisa a pedido "c++"

1 a resposta

Manipulando parâmetros padrão no cython

Estou quebrando algum código c ++ usando cython e não tenho certeza de qual é a melhor maneira de lidar com parâmetros com valores padrão. No meu código c ++, tenho uma função para a qual os parâmetros têm valores padrão. Eu gostaria de ...

1 a resposta

Como defino uma função de modelo dentro de uma classe de modelo fora da definição de classe?

Dado: template <class T> class Foo { public: template <class U> void bar(); };Como implementar barra fora da definição de classe enquanto ainda tenho acesso aos parâmetros de modelo T e U?

4 a resposta

Por que o modelo de função não pode ser parcialmente especializado?

Eu sei que a especificação de idioma proíbeparcial especialização do modelo de função. Eu gostaria de saber o raciocínio por que o proíbe? Eles não são úteis? template<typename T, typename U> void f() {} //allowed! template<> void ...

4 a resposta

Vários produtores, consumidor único

Eu tenho que desenvolver um aplicativo multithread, onde haverá vários threads, cada thread gera um log de eventos personalizado e precisa ser salvo na fila salva (não no Microsoft MSMQ). Haverá outro encadeamento que lerá os dados de log da ...

1 a resposta

O que add_lvalue_reference faz?

Eu tenho essa classe que cria um caminho para um simulador montecarlo, onde é necessário, cria caminhos de números inteiros a partir de uma matriz de entradas disponíveis. Assim, por exemplo, poderíamos ter um caminho de comprimento 3 desenhado a ...

2 a resposta

(WMI) ExecMethod out parâmetro - ResultingSnapshot é NULL, independentemente do resultado da chamada, por quê?

Estou usando o WMI para criar um ponto de verificação RCT. Abaixo está o trecho de código. O problema é quando eu chamo o métodoCreate Snapshot usandoExecMethodo ponto de verificação é criado, mas oResultingSnapshot ainda aponta paraNULL. Como a ...

2 a resposta

Passando um ponteiro compartilhado por referência ou por valor como parâmetro para uma classe

Um ponteiro compartilhado deve ser passado por referência ou por valor como parâmetro para uma classe se for copiado para uma variável de membro? A cópia do ponteiro compartilhado aumentará a contagem de referências e eu não quero fazer cópias ...

3 a resposta

Erro ao declarar uma variável de loop for dentro do loop

Considere este trecho de um programa C: for(int i = 0; i < 5; i++) { int i = 10; // <- Note the local variable printf("%d", i); }Compila sem nenhum erro e, quando executado, fornece a seguinte saída: 1010101010Mas se eu escrever um loop ...

1 a resposta

Criando impulso sob msys, não consigo encontrar mingw.jam

Preciso criar um impulso para usar a biblioteca regex. Eu era capaz de criar bjam usando bootstrap.sh assim: ./bootstrap.sh --with-toolset=mingwNota - se eu deixar de fora a compilação do argumento --with-toolset = mingw falhar - a inicialização ...

2 a resposta

O set_target_properties no CMake substitui o CMAKE_CXX_FLAGS?

No início do meu projeto CMake, estou configurando sinalizadores gerais de compilação na variável CMAKE_CXX_FLAGS, como set(CMAKE_CXX_FLAGS "-W -Wall ${CMAKE_CXX_FLAGS}")Posteriormente, preciso anexar sinalizadores de compilação adicionais ...